Man kills fellow Delhi night shelter resident over rape bid

Published by
Patriot Bureau

A 20-year-old man, staying in a north Delhi night shelter, allegedly bludgeoned a fellow resident’s head with a stone over rape bid.

The accused, hailing from Bihar, resided in the Khoya Mandi ‘rain basera (night shelter)’ in Mori Gate and was subsequently apprehended in Patna.

Deputy Commissioner of Police (North) MK Meena revealed that the police received a PCR call on January 19, reporting the discovery of a body at the Mori Gate DDA park.

The victim had apparent signs of violence, including blood clots over the mouth and cut marks above the eye. Following a forensic examination, the police transferred the body to a mortuary and initiated a murder case.

Through the analysis of over 50 CCTV camera footage and local intelligence, the police identified the victim as Pramod Kumar Shukla from Uttar Pradesh’s Jalaun district. Shukla, who worked at a shop in Khoya Mandi, resided in a night shelter.

Further investigation uncovered that Shukla was last seen with a fellow resident named Rajesh, who was subsequently apprehended in Patna.

During interrogation, Rajesh confessed that Shukla had been pressuring him into engaging in unnatural sex acts. In response to this coercion, Rajesh formulated a plan to “eliminate” Shukla, carrying out the act of murder on January 17, according to the police.
